TL;DR: Una página web cuesta entre USD 1.500 y USD 25.000. Una app móvil entre USD 10.000 y USD 80.000. Un sistema web a medida entre USD 5.000 y USD 50.000. El precio depende de la complejidad, las fases incluidas y el tipo de proveedor. Esta guía cubre todo el proceso: cómo definir qué necesitás, cómo leer un presupuesto, qué preguntar y cómo comparar correctamente.
Guía completa: presupuesto de software para pymes 2025
Si estás pensando en digitalizar tu negocio y no sabés por dónde empezar, esta es la guía que necesitás. Cubrimos todo: desde cómo decidir qué tipo de software necesitás hasta cómo interpretar un presupuesto y elegir al proveedor correcto. Sin tecnicismos innecesarios, con precios reales del mercado argentino 2025.
Puntos clave
- Hay tres tipos principales de software para pymes: páginas web, apps móviles y sistemas web a medida
- El precio varía enormemente según la complejidad, las fases incluidas y el tipo de proveedor
- Los presupuestos no son comparables si no cotizan las mismas fases del proyecto
- El costo total a 3 años (incluyendo mantenimiento) es el número correcto para comparar opciones
- La etapa más crítica y más subestimada es el discovery antes de desarrollar
Parte 1: ¿Qué tipo de software necesita tu negocio?
Antes de buscar presupuesto, tenés que saber qué estás cotizando. Las categorías principales:
Página web o sitio institucional
Para qué sirve: Presencia digital, captación de leads, posicionamiento en Google, información de tu negocio para clientes potenciales.
Cuándo es lo correcto:
- Tu objetivo principal es que los clientes te encuentren online
- Querés mostrar tus servicios, productos o portfolio
- Necesitás un blog para generar contenido y SEO
- Querés tener un canal de contacto digital profesional
Cuándo NO es suficiente:
- Necesitás que los clientes realicen transacciones complejas online
- Querés gestionar procesos internos de la empresa
- Necesitás acceso a funciones del celular (GPS, cámara, notificaciones push)
Rango de precios: USD 1.500 – USD 25.000
App móvil
Para qué sirve: Canal de interacción frecuente con clientes o empleados desde el celular, acceso a hardware del dispositivo (GPS, cámara, notificaciones push).
Cuándo es lo correcto:
- Tus usuarios van a interactuar con tu negocio desde el celular más de 2–3 veces por semana
- Necesitás GPS en tiempo real, notificaciones push críticas o pagos con Face ID
- La retención de usuarios en el homescreen es estratégica para tu modelo de negocio
- Ya tenés usuarios activos que lo demandan
Cuándo NO es lo correcto:
- Es para uso interno de empleados que trabajan desde escritorio
- El objetivo principal es presencia digital o captación de leads
- No tenés presupuesto mayor a USD 12.000 (empezá por web o PWA)
Rango de precios: USD 10.000 – USD 80.000
Sistema web a medida
Para qué sirve: Gestión de procesos internos o externos de la empresa que requieren lógica de negocio compleja, múltiples roles de usuario y base de datos propia.
Cuándo es lo correcto:
- Querés digitalizar procesos que hoy hacés en Excel o papel
- Necesitás un CRM, ERP, sistema de stock, portal de clientes o intranet
- Los empleados trabajan principalmente desde escritorio
- Tenés procesos muy específicos que los softwares genéricos no cubren bien
Rango de precios: USD 5.000 – USD 50.000+
| Criterio | Página web | App móvil | Sistema web |
|---|---|---|---|
| Objetivo principal | Presencia digital / SEO | Interacción frecuente mobile | Gestión de procesos |
| Usuario principal | Clientes externos | Clientes o empleados en campo | Empleados / usuarios internos |
| Dispositivo de uso | Cualquiera | Celular | Desktop (principalmente) |
| Requiere instalación | No | Sí (App Store / Google Play) | No |
| Acceso a hardware | No | Sí | Limitado |
| Costo inicial típico | USD 1.500–25.000 | USD 10.000–80.000 | USD 5.000–50.000 |
| Costo mensual (operación) | USD 30–400 | USD 300–2.000 | USD 200–1.500 |
Parte 2: Precios de referencia por tipo de proyecto
Páginas web
| Tipo de web | Funcionalidades típicas | Rango de precios (USD) |
|---|---|---|
| Landing page | 1 página, formulario de contacto, sin admin | 800–2.500 |
| Web corporativa | 5–8 páginas, blog, formulario, SEO básico | 2.000–6.000 |
| Web con funcionalidades | Sistema de turnos, reservas, catálogo interactivo | 4.000–15.000 |
| E-commerce básico | Catálogo, carrito, pagos, gestión de stock | 5.000–18.000 |
| Plataforma web compleja | Portal de clientes, dashboards, integraciones | 15.000–40.000 |
Apps móviles
| Tipo de app | Funcionalidades típicas | Rango de precios (USD) |
|---|---|---|
| MVP básico | 5–8 pantallas, funcionalidades core, React Native | 10.000–20.000 |
| App de servicios | Turnos, reservas, perfil de usuario, pagos | 18.000–35.000 |
| App con GPS | Tracking en tiempo real, mapas, ubicación | 25.000–50.000 |
| App de delivery | Cliente + repartidor + panel admin | 30.000–60.000 |
| Marketplace | Múltiples tipos de usuario, pagos con escrow | 50.000–100.000+ |
| App nativa iOS + Android | Swift + Kotlin, dos codebases | 40.000–120.000 |
Sistemas web a medida
| Tipo de sistema | Funcionalidades típicas | Rango de precios (USD) |
|---|---|---|
| Sistema simple | 1–2 roles, 5–8 módulos, sin integraciones externas | 5.000–12.000 |
| CRM o sistema de gestión | 3–4 roles, pipeline, reportes básicos | 12.000–25.000 |
| Sistema de gestión complejo | Múltiples roles, integraciones, reportes avanzados | 25.000–50.000 |
| Plataforma SaaS | Software para múltiples empresas, multitenancy | 50.000–150.000+ |
Parte 3: Qué determina el precio
Variables de primer orden (mayor impacto)
1. Complejidad de los flujos de negocio ¿Cuántos pasos tiene cada proceso? ¿Cuántas validaciones, excepciones y casos borde? Un proceso simple es lineal. Uno complejo tiene bifurcaciones, estados intermedios y lógica condicional.
2. Cantidad de roles de usuario Cada rol tiene sus pantallas, permisos y flujos distintos. Un sistema con 2 roles es muy diferente a uno con 5. Multiplicá la complejidad por cada rol adicional.
3. Integraciones con sistemas externos AFIP, MercadoPago, sistemas bancarios, APIs de terceros, sistemas legacy — cada integración agrega tiempo de desarrollo y, sobre todo, tiempo de testing.
4. Tipo de proveedor elegido Un freelancer senior cobra menos por hora que una agencia, pero puede tener menos procesos y capacidad de absorber proyectos más complejos.
Variables de segundo orden
- Requerimientos de diseño: ¿Diseño custom o template?
- Soporte a múltiples idiomas / monedas: Agrega complejidad técnica
- Volumen de usuarios esperado: Arquitectura para 100 usuarios vs. 100.000
- Requerimientos de seguridad: Doble factor, auditoría de acciones, cifrado de datos sensibles
- Migración de datos: Importar datos de sistemas existentes es siempre más complejo de lo esperado
💡 Consejo
La variable que más impacta en el costo y que menos se entiende es la "complejidad oculta": la cantidad de excepciones, casos borde y estados intermedios que tiene el proceso de negocio. Un proceso que parece simple puede tener decenas de reglas implícitas que el equipo descubre durante el desarrollo.
Parte 4: Qué incluye (y qué no) un presupuesto de software
Las fases de un proyecto de software
Un proyecto de software bien gestionado tiene estas fases, cada una con su costo propio:
| Fase | Qué se hace | % del costo total | ¿Suele estar incluida? |
|---|---|---|---|
| Discovery | Análisis de procesos, definición del alcance, arquitectura técnica | 5–10% | No siempre |
| Diseño UX | Wireframes, flujos de navegación, prototipo funcional | 10–15% | No siempre |
| Diseño UI | Sistema visual, componentes, diseño de pantallas | 8–12% | No siempre |
| Desarrollo front-end | Interfaces de usuario, componentes, navegación | 20–30% | Sí |
| Desarrollo back-end | Lógica de negocio, API, base de datos | 25–35% | Sí (preguntar) |
| Testing y QA | Pruebas funcionales, regresión, dispositivos, performance | 8–12% | No siempre |
| Deploy | Configuración de servidores, publicación en tiendas | 3–5% | No siempre |
| Capacitación | Entrenamiento del equipo, documentación | 2–4% | Rara vez |
| Garantía post-lanzamiento | Corrección de bugs por 30–90 días | Incluida en precio total | Preguntar alcance |
Siempre preguntá: ¿Qué fases están incluidas en el presupuesto? ¿Qué pasa con los bugs que aparecen después del lanzamiento?
Costos de operación post-lanzamiento
Además del desarrollo, hay costos recurrentes que empiezan el día del lanzamiento:
| Concepto | Web | App | Sistema web |
|---|---|---|---|
| Hosting | USD 10–300/mes | USD 50–500/mes | USD 50–500/mes |
| SSL | USD 0 (Let's Encrypt) | — | USD 0 |
| Cuentas de tiendas | — | USD 8–10/mes | — |
| Monitoreo | USD 0–50/mes | USD 20–150/mes | USD 20–150/mes |
| Mantenimiento técnico | USD 50–300/mes | USD 200–1.000/mes | USD 200–1.000/mes |
| Total mensual | USD 60–650 | USD 270–1.660 | USD 270–1.650 |
Parte 5: Tipos de proveedor y qué esperar de cada uno
| Tipo de proveedor | Tarifa hora | Mejor para | Riesgo principal |
|---|---|---|---|
| Freelancer individual | USD 30–70 | Proyectos bien definidos, presupuesto ajustado | Disponibilidad, continuidad si hay problema personal |
| Duo / equipo informal | USD 35–60 | Proyectos medianos, buena relación precio-calidad | Coordinación, responsabilidad difusa |
| Agencia pequeña (2–8 personas) | USD 60–90 | Proyectos medianos con algo de proceso | Capacidad limitada para picos de trabajo |
| Agencia mediana (10–30 personas) | USD 80–120 | Proyectos complejos con necesidad de proceso | Mayor burocracia, precio más alto |
| Empresa de software regional | USD 100–150+ | Proyectos grandes, necesidad de garantías | Precio alto, menor agilidad |
Cómo evaluar a un proveedor:
- ¿Tienen portfolio de proyectos similares al tuyo?
- ¿Podés hablar con 2–3 clientes anteriores?
- ¿Quiénes van a trabajar en tu proyecto específicamente?
- ¿Cómo manejan los cambios de scope?
- ¿El código va a ser tuyo desde el día uno?
Parte 6: El proceso de decisión paso a paso
Paso 1: Definí el problema, no la solución
Antes de decidir si necesitás una web, una app o un sistema, definí qué problema querés resolver:
- "Perdo leads porque los clientes no me pueden contactar fácilmente" → Landing page + formulario
- "Mi equipo pierde tiempo coordinándose por WhatsApp" → Sistema web interno
- "Mis clientes quieren ver el estado de su pedido desde el celular" → App o web responsive
Paso 2: Determiná el alcance del MVP
¿Cuáles son las 3–5 funcionalidades sin las que el sistema no tiene sentido? Eso es el MVP. Todo lo demás va a la versión 2.
Paso 3: Preparar el brief
Un buen brief incluye:
- El problema que se quiere resolver y para quién
- Las funcionalidades del MVP listadas y priorizadas
- Los flujos principales del proceso (paso a paso)
- Las integraciones necesarias con sistemas externos
- Restricciones de presupuesto y tiempo
- Dispositivos y plataformas objetivo
Paso 4: Pedir al menos 3 presupuestos
Pedir a 3 proveedores de distinto perfil (un freelancer, una agencia pequeña y una agencia mediana) para tener comparación real. Exigir que cada uno desglose el presupuesto por fase.
Paso 5: Comparar el costo total a 3 años
No solo el costo inicial de desarrollo, sino:
- Desarrollo (único)
- Hosting y operación (mensual × 36)
- Mantenimiento y soporte (mensual × 36)
- Actualizaciones mayores (2 veces por año × 3 años)
Paso 6: Evaluar el equipo, no solo el precio
El presupuesto más bajo raramente es la mejor ecuación. Evaluá la experiencia en proyectos similares, la calidad del proceso propuesto y la transparencia en la forma de manejar los cambios.
⚠️ Atención
El error más caro de una pyme al contratar software: elegir el proveedor más barato para la primera versión y después tener que contratar a otro proveedor para rehacerla porque el código no era mantenible. Cuesta el doble.
Parte 7: Cómo se estructura el contrato
Un buen contrato de desarrollo de software incluye:
- Alcance detallado: Lista de funcionalidades incluidas y excluidas
- Estructura de pagos por hitos: No por fechas, sino por entregables verificables
- Propiedad del código: El cliente es dueño del repositorio desde el día uno
- Manejo de cambios de scope: Procedimiento escrito para cambios y costo adicional
- Garantía post-lanzamiento: Alcance y duración de la cobertura de bugs
- Confidencialidad: NDA si el proyecto tiene información sensible
- Resolución de conflictos: Mediación arbitral antes de recurrir a la justicia
Recursos para seguir
- Cotizador de Deepyze para estimar el costo de tu proyecto específico
- Sistema web vs. app móvil: cuál elegir
- Errores al pedir presupuesto de app
- Cuánto cuesta desarrollar una app móvil
- Cuánto cuesta una página web
- Software a medida vs. enlatado
Preguntas frecuentes
- Depende del tipo de software. Una página web corporativa cuesta entre USD 2.000 y USD 8.000. Un sistema web a medida (CRM, gestión interna) entre USD 8.000 y USD 35.000. Una app móvil entre USD 10.000 y USD 60.000. Los precios varían según la complejidad de los flujos, el tipo de proveedor y las fases que incluye el presupuesto. El error más común es comparar presupuestos que no incluyen las mismas fases.
- Las tres variables que más encarecen un proyecto de software son: la cantidad de integraciones con sistemas externos (AFIP, MercadoPago, sistemas legacy), la cantidad de roles de usuario distintos con sus flujos específicos, y la complejidad de la lógica de negocio (validaciones, estados, aprobaciones). Los reportes y dashboards analíticos también suman significativamente al costo total.
- Para comparar correctamente: 1) Exigí que cada proveedor desglose el presupuesto por fase (discovery, diseño, desarrollo, testing, deploy). 2) Pedí una lista explícita de qué incluye y qué no. 3) Preguntá cuánto cuesta el mantenimiento mensual después del lanzamiento. 4) Calculá el costo total a 3 años. Un presupuesto bajo que no incluye diseño ni testing puede ser más caro en el total que uno más alto que sí los incluye.
- Una landing page tarda 2–4 semanas. Una web corporativa 4–8 semanas. Un sistema web de mediana complejidad 3–5 meses. Una app móvil básica (MVP) 3–5 meses. Un sistema complejo o plataforma con múltiples módulos 6–12 meses. Estos tiempos asumen un equipo dedicado y alcance bien definido desde el inicio. Sin discovery completo, los plazos se pueden extender un 30–50%.
- Sí, y es la inversión con mejor retorno en cualquier proyecto de software. Un discovery de 1–2 semanas (USD 1.500–5.000) puede reducir el costo total del proyecto entre un 20% y un 40% al eliminar ambigüedades, identificar sorpresas técnicas tempranas y producir una especificación que todos los proveedores pueden cotizar sobre la misma base. Sin discovery, cada proveedor asume cosas distintas y los presupuestos no son comparables.
